分類法「アーティスト」でタグ付けされたカテゴリ「リリース」の投稿をアーティストの名前でプルするWordPressのクエリがあります-(これはたまたまこのページのタイトルです。)それはうまく機能します。アーティスト名/ページ タイトルを 3 語で使用するまで。したがって、「san gabriel」は機能しますが、「coyote clean up」は機能しません。これは古いサイトで、いくつかの目的で魔法のフィールドを使用しましたが、それがどのように問題の一部になるかはわかりません.
<?php query_posts( array(
'category_name' => 'releases',
'artist' => wp_title("",false),
'showposts' => 0
) )?>
<?php if (have_posts()) : while (have_posts()) : the_post(); ?>
<div <?php post_class() ?> id="post-<?php the_ID(); ?>">
<img alt="release image" src="<?php echo get ('release_info_release_image') ?>">
</div>
<?php endwhile; ?>
<?php else : ?>
<p>there are currently no releases posted for this artist.</p>
<?php endif; ?>
<?php wp_reset_query(); ?>
これは、ページ タイトルとタグ付けされた分類法の間にタイプミスがないことを示す図です。
San Gabriel のページが投稿されます。Coyote Clean Up はそうではありません。タイトルとアーティストタグで彼らの名前を「Coyote Clean」に変更すると、IT WORKS ... 一言バンドが機能します。2 つの単語バンドが機能します。スリーワードバンドはそうではありません。
これが起こる理由は考えられません。
何か案は?
OK - ここに 4 つの単語があり、機能しています...